Well the crawdad looks like a shrimp but the water strider came out ok. Then there is the tadpole, it's a Beaver skin zonker with a foam popper head turned backwards on the hook. To neutralize the buoyancy of the foam head I gave it 13 tight wraps of solder around the hook shaft starting one wrap back from the eye of the hook. Then there is the frog popper.... Foam head, green tinsel lower body, and fluffy marabou for the legs as well as the tail and claws on the crawdad

I don't have a lot of experience with booby flies. I have only fished with them once. But I did manage to catch two crappie with a green one. Yes they have the foam head and body. But I use a little lead wire on the hook shank to give them almost neutral buoyancy with floating line (meaning they will sink but very slowly). I tried them with no weight and did not like how they swam.
